Today we’d like to introduce you to Devon Gibson
Hi Devon, so excited to have you with us today. What can you tell us about your story?
I was born and raised in Waco, TX. In 2013, I moved to Arlington to attend the University of Texas at Arlington. I later graduated with a BBA concentrated in Finance in Spring 2017. In 2016, I joined my first cover band, The Signature Band, led by George Anderson (bassist & vocalist). I was in this band until its retirement in 2021. During that time, I joined and sang with multiple other bands in the DFW metroplex. The gigs were predominantly weddings and corporate parties & events. Over the years, I was granted opportunities to play my own gigs in bars/lounges locally.
Would you say it’s been a smooth road, and if not what are some of the biggest challenges you’ve faced along the way?
Typical struggles of an independent contractor working with multiple bands/companies. If there’s no gig, there’s no money. But once I made connections and more people saw & heard what I can do, more opportunities to work came my way.

Do you have any advice for those just starting out?
Be eager to learn & grow. Remember constructive criticism is NECESSARY for improvement. Be present and enjoy every moment. Put yourself out there and connect with likeminded individuals. Bet on yourself at all times and believe in yourself. I wish I knew more about the cover band industry, the ins and outs and such. But I didn’t have this back in Waco when I was growing up. I didn’t know that having a career as a cover band singer was even a thing.
